Learn more about Orange Walk

Known as 'Sugar City,' Orange Walk offers riverside adventures and Maya ruins exploration at nearby Lamanai Archaeological Reserve. Sample the town's famous street tacos while arranging guided tours to spot wildlife in the surrounding jungle waterways.

Things to do in Orange Walk

Shopping

In Orange Walk, visit the local market where you can find vibrant handicrafts and traditional souvenirs. If you're up for a drive, head to Corozal Town’s Market, about 24.1km away, which offers a wider selection of artisanal goods and local delicacies to bring home.

Recreation

Experience the tranquillity of the La Isla Resort, where you can unwind by the river and enjoy yoga sessions amidst nature. For a refreshing outdoor experience, explore the nearby Crooked Tree Wildlife Sanctuary, perfect for birdwatching and serene walks.

Adventure

Explore the serene Lamanai Mayan Ruins, reachable by a scenic boat ride along the New River. Experience ancient history while surrounded by lush rainforest and diverse wildlife. For thrill-seekers, the nearby Crooked Tree Wildlife Sanctuary offers opportunities for canoeing and birdwatching in a tranquil setting.

Nightlife

Experience the vibrant nightlife at the Orange Walk Town Centre, where you can mingle with locals and visitors alike. Enjoy live music and cold beverages at the popular La Casa de la Cultura, or unwind at the lively Club 88, known for its energetic atmosphere and dance floor.

Best time to go to Orange Walk

The best time to visit Orange Walk can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Orange Walk falls in August, when visitor numbers are slightly low and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Orange Walk falls in January,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with light r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January73.8°F (23.2°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
February75.6°F (24.2°C)No R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
March77.4°F (25.2°C)No R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
April80.2°F (26.8°C)No R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
May81.7°F (27.6°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
June81.3°F (27.4°C)Moderate R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
July81.7°F (27.6°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ighAverage
August81.9°F (27.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
September81.1°F (27.3°C)Moderate R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ly Low
October79.2°F (26.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ly Low
November76.1°F (24.5°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ly Low
December74.8°F (23.8°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High

What's the seasonal weather in Orange Walk?
The hottest months are usually May and August, with an average temperature of 27°C, while the coldest months are January and December, with an average of 24°C. The rainiest months in Orange Walk are June, September, October and August, with each month seeing an average of 204 mm of rainfall.
